About Deville
Deville carries an air of old-world sophistication, a name that feels both familiar in its sound and wonderfully uncommon in its usage. Rooted in Old French, meaning "of the town or city," it evokes images of medieval European charm, yet it effortlessly transcends time to feel perfectly at home in the contemporary world. This is a name for parents who appreciate a distinctive choice that whispers elegance rather than shouts it, perhaps those with an affinity for European history or a desire for a surname-as-first-name trend that stands apart from the more common picks. Unlike many place-based names, Deville feels less like a geographical marker and more like an inherited legacy, suggesting a connection to community and heritage without being overtly traditional.

Frequently Asked Questions About Deville
What is the origin and meaning of the name Deville?
Deville has Old French origins, and its meaning translates to "of the town" or "of the city." It carries a sophisticated and historic feel.
Is Deville a common name?
No, Deville is noted as a rare name, offering a distinctive choice for parents seeking something less common.
What does Deville mean?
Deville means "of the town/city". It is derived from French.
What is the origin of Deville?
Deville originates from Old French. Its cultural origin is French.
Is Deville a male or female name?
Deville is a unisex name.
How do you pronounce Deville?
Deville is pronounced "duh-VEEL".
What language does Deville come from?
Deville comes from Old French.
Is Deville a popular name?
Deville is considered a very rare name, and its popularity trend is rare.
